Pregnancy requires local immune tolerization. Oocyte donation (OD) pregnancies, with extensive fetal-maternal HLA mismatching, are at higher risk of pre-eclampsia. We hypothesize that immune adaptations are needed at the fetal-maternal interface to maintain healthy pregnancy despite high HLA dissimilarity. This study is by X. Tian et al. The data sets concern raw HLA genotyping data, imaging mass cytometry data and RNA sequencing data generated from decidua basalis of fully-allogeneic healthy pregnancies, semi-allogeneic healthy pregnancies, and fully-allogeneic pregnancies with pre-eclampsia.
